        My wife and I subscribe to CBS All Access, and we've had zero issues so far. I did the free trial for The Masters, and I'll continue to subscribe for the PGA Tour in addition to NFL, college hoops, etc. It's been a good experience so far.

        We got rid of cable a month or so ago. We already had 2 Roku devices, but I paid for two months of Sling and got a third one for free for our other TV. A couple weeks into being a Sling user, and I'm not super impressed by the picture quality compared to Fubo TV (the only other service I've tried). Fubo has a much nicer picture, and as a big soccer guy, there are plenty of options with this service. That being said, I've had some short freeze issues during my free trial with Fubo.

        I'm locked in with Sling until the first week of June, but I'm not sure which way I'll go after that. If I can count on Fubo, I'll probably go that route. If I can't, I'll probably stick with Sling. I'm a bit of a graphics guy, so it's hard for me to see Sling lag so far behind Fubo in the picture category. Decisions decisions..

        Any recent feedback on Fubo TV?

              Yeah they're sneaky with their pricing cause it's $40/month but if you want DVR, that's another $15/mo.

              Edit: Well I was partly wrong about the DVR. It comes with 50 hours of Cloud DVR. For that extra $15/mo, you get 200 hours and ability to fast forward through recorded commercials.
